APP下载

部署QoS提高城域网承载多种业务的能力

2012-08-09姜希军邵梅

电信工程技术与标准化 2012年9期
关键词:城域网队列报文

姜希军,邵梅

(中国联通青岛分公司,青岛 266071)

1 城域网承载业务的不同类型决定了部署QoS的必要性

当前随着互联网络的快速发展,互联网业务类型也由最初的上网业务发展到需要承载话音和视频等新的互联网业务,为每一种新的业务搭建一个专用网络显然是不现实的,也是很不经济的,通过IP城域网承载多种业务类型成为一种自然的选择。IP城域网的特点之一就是提供尽力而为的服务,但是对于那些实时性要求较高的业务,比如话音业务和视频直播业务,仅仅提供尽力而为的服务显然无法满足业务需求,这样就对网络质量提出了更高的要求。

衡量网络质量的指标一般有带宽,分组丢失率,端到端的延时和抖动这样几个方面。QoS技术综合考虑了这些质量指标。在城域网中部署QoS可以很好地满足不同业务对网络质量的不同要求。

2 QoS技术特点

QoS(Quality of Service)是带宽、分组延时和分组丢失率等参数描述的关于分组传输的质量。

QoS有3种服务模型:尽力而为(Best-Effort),综合服务(IntServ)模型和区分服务(DiffServ)模型。

Best-Effort 是最简单的服务模型,应用程序可以在任何时候,发出任意数量的报文,而且不需要事先获得批准,也不需要通知网络。对Best-Effort 服务,网络尽最大的可能性来发送报文,但对时延、可靠性等性能不提供任何保证。对于一般的互联网业务,如电子邮件,FTP等,这种服务模型就可以满足需求。

综合服务(IntServ, Integrated Service)模型在发送报文前,需要向网络申请特定的服务。这个请求是通过信令(目前采用资源预留协议RSVP)来完成的,应用程序先通知网络发送报文的流量参数和所需的服务质量请求(如带宽、时延等),应用程序在收到网络预留资源的确认信息后,才开始发送报文,发送报文被控制在流量参数规定的范围内。

DiffServ模型是根据优先级标记,对特定的行为集合(BA)使用的逐跳转发行为(PHB,Per-Hop Behavior),通过拥塞管理机制、流量整形、流量监管、拥塞避免等作相应的区别处理,从而实现端到端服务质量的保障。

DiffServ除尽力而为服务外,还可以提供以下两种服务:

第一,加速转发(EF,Expedited Forwarding):提供严格的优先转发服务。

第二,确保转发(AF,Assured Forwarding):提供传送保证,并允许超额质量保证。

DiffServ对于数据分组的处理过程可以用图1来说明:在DiffServ域的边缘节点进行流量的分类、标记和流量控制,在DiffServ域中的节点,按照流量的分类标志执行PHB,进行转发、拥塞管理、重标记等操作。

DiffServ和IntServ两种服务模型比较起来,IntServ是更为严格意义上的服务保证,在无法确保资源需求的情况下不建立传送通道,但其对设备要求较高,兼容性较差;DiffServ是区分类型、无连接状态的保障模式,有更好的灵活性和可扩展性。在目前城域网中继带宽资源丰富、设备种类复杂的情况下,DiffServ是更适合的QoS服务模式。

3 结合青岛城域网的现状,合理部署QoS

3.1 VLAN规划和使用

在城域网中部署QoS必然要涉及到VLAN的规划和使用问题。目前,青岛城域网除了光纤独享的行业用户采用单层VLAN的方式之外,普遍采用了QinQ(即Double VLAN)的方式,青岛城域网VLAN的使用现状如表1所示。

图1 DiffServ处理数据分组的过程

表1 青岛城域网VLAN使用现状表

以上的使用情况没有考虑IPTV多播业务,为此,提出表2所示的VLAN规划的建议。

新的VLAN规划建议是按照不同用户不同业务分配不同VLAN的原则进行的,也充分考虑了现网的状况,如果现网设备开通IPTV多播业务,可以按照新的规划整改,对于新增设备严格按照规划执行。

3.2 业务等级划分和QoS策略使用

目前青岛城域网中承载的业务除了一般的互联网接入业务之外,还承载了大客户的VPN业务,NGN的话音业务,还有目前正在试点的IPTV业务。可以根据这些业务类型定义3个业务等级,共使用3个标记,并分别使用不同的拥塞避免机制和QoS策略,如表3所示。

总体的QoS分类和标记规划建议如表4所示。

在策略使用方面,主要进行了如下的考虑:

分类和标记策略:对电信级话音、MPLS VPN大客户业务,基于端口和VLAN进行分类和标记。

队列调度策略:队列调度采用PQ加WFQ的方式,并对PQ进行限速,队列的带宽分配根据实际业务流量模型决定。

表2 青岛城域网VLAN规划建议表

拥塞避免策略:NGN业务等级设置在绝对优先级队列,并预留了足够的带宽,且该业务等级中的控制流量不允许丢包,因此NGN业务等级不实施WRED,对其它队列使用WRED调度。

限速和整形:针对公众业务,在PE的入口根据多种方式进行限速。

3.3 在城域网中分层次分别部署QoS

按照城域网的不同层次,QoS的部署情况可以用如图2进行说明。

3.3.1 接入网二层网络QoS部署

不信任最终用户带来的CoS值,在网络边界启用内层802.1q VLAN时,根据确认的业务进行CoS标记,嵌套外层VLAN时,将内层CoS复制到外层;信任上游三层网络映射来的CoS值。

表3 业务等级分类及相应QoS策略

表4 QoS分类和标记表

一般二层以太网交换机支持4个队列,让相应的4类业务分别对应4个队列,优先级最高的话音业务采用PQ队列,预留2.5倍带宽;IPTV和VPN业务分别放入两个不同的WFQ队列,预留2倍带宽;最后普通上网业务使用剩余带宽。

3.3.2 三层网络QoS部署

对于三层网络,一般采用DSCP来进行分类和标记。通过PQ或WFQ队列调度技术对重要业务进行拥塞管理和拥塞避免,对于IP专线业务,如果用户合同约定速率小于接入端口速率,采用流量监管策略(policing),限定用户的CIR值,并根据合同约定或根据网络容量情况,设置合理的突发流量,在设备支持的情况下采用双速率三色标记,对超过部分进行降级重标记。

3.3.3 跨DS域的QoS部署

根据青岛城域网现状,跨DS域QoS部署有两种情况:

(1)城域网——China169省网。 主要应用于用户跨地市的关键业务保障或大客户互联网访问保障。可参照前述城域网QoS规划,设计IP省网的QoS部署策略。

图2 分层部署QoS策略图

(2)城域网——IP承载A网。为实现本地软交换的互联,并逐步实现各分公司本地承载网络的互通,按照现行的技术体制,可以通过集团公司统一建设的IP承载A网来实现。另外,某些使用城域网接入的集团软交换类业务(如点对点视频通信),也需要城域网与IP承载A网互联(仅VPN互联)。

当本地DS域内的QoS保障业务需要进入IP承载A网时,需要在IP承载A网的PE接入端口,按照集团统一规划进行重标记,目前采用MPLS OPTION-A的方式实现VPN 跨域互联。

4 结束语

在青岛联通城域网上逐步推进QoS部署,可以提高业务的服务质量和用户感知度,支撑更多的宽带差异化产品,促进宽带业务的更好发展,为此应当根据业务发展的需要和投资建设综合考虑,采取网络超配扩容或采用QoS精细化的管理,以保障个别重点业务的服务质量要求。部署QoS的目的是根据业务分类尽可能的满足业务对资源的需求,而非尽可能限制业务对资源的需求,即更多地使用拥塞管理而非流量监管。同时也应当认识到QoS并不能创造带宽,但是可以有效地进行网络资源管理。部署QoS时,尽可能在靠近用户的地方进行流量的识别分类和标记。

[1] RFC 2216, Network Element Service Specification Template[S].

[2] ITU-T Y.1541, Network Performance 0bjectives for IP-based Services[S].

[3] RFC 2475, An Architecture for Differentiated Services[S].

[4] RFC 2547, BGP/MPLS VPNs[S].

[5] RFC 2597, Assured Forwarding PHB Group[S].

[6] RFC 2598, An Expedited Forwarding PHB[S].

[7] RFC 2697, A Single Rate Three Color Marker[S].

[8] RFC 2917, A Core MPLS IP VPN Architecture[S].

[9] RFC 3246, An Expedited Forwarding PHB[S].

[10] RFC 3270, Multiprotocol Label Switching (MPLS) Support of Differentiated Services[S].

[11] Szigeti T,Hattingh C. End-to-End QoS Network Design[M], 2004/9

[12] YD/T 1071-2000, IP电话网关设备技术要求[S].

[13] 中国联通综合业务IP承载网MPLSVPN接入规范[S]. 2009,4.

[14] 中国联通综合业务IP承载网网络数据配置规范[S]. 2009,4.

[15] IP承载网与城域网跨域互联(OptionA方式)[S]. 2009,4.

猜你喜欢

城域网队列报文
基于J1939 协议多包报文的时序研究及应用
IP城域网/智能城域网BGP收敛震荡的分析方法
CTCS-2级报文数据管理需求分析和实现
队列里的小秘密
基于多队列切换的SDN拥塞控制*
浅析反驳类报文要点
在队列里
面向FTTH业务的IP城域网优化改造设计
丰田加速驶入自动驾驶队列
IP城域网建设中技术及应用情况分析